Living with regrets can be a heavy burden to carry. It can weigh you down and prevent you from moving forward. That's why it's important to release all regrets and live with gratitude in the present moment. This affirmation can help you let go of the past and focus on the present.

Regrets are often tied to past events that we wish we could change. Maybe you made a mistake or missed an opportunity. Whatever the reason, dwelling on the past won't change it. Instead, focus on what you can do now. You can't change the past, but you can change your attitude towards it.

Living with gratitude means appreciating what you have in the present moment. It's easy to get caught up in what you don't have or what you wish you had. But focusing on what you do have can bring a sense of peace and contentment. Gratitude can help you see the good in your life and appreciate the people and things around you.

When you release all regrets and live with gratitude in the present moment, you're giving yourself permission to let go of the past and focus on the present. You're acknowledging that you can't change what's already happened, but you can change how you feel about it. You're also acknowledging that there are good things in your life right now that you can be grateful for.

Living with gratitude doesn't mean you have to be happy all the time. It's okay to feel sad or angry or frustrated. But it's important to acknowledge those feelings and then focus on the good things in your life. When you focus on the good, you're more likely to attract more good into your life.

Releasing all regrets can be a difficult process. It may take time and effort to let go of the past. But it's worth it. When you release regrets, you're freeing yourself from a heavy burden. You're allowing yourself to move forward and create a better future.

Living with gratitude in the present moment can also be a challenge. It's easy to get caught up in negative thoughts and feelings. But with practice, you can learn to focus on the good things in your life. You can learn to appreciate the people and things around you.
